Latest Trends
Several key trends are shaping the landscape of the Aerospace Interior Adhesives Market
Lightweighting Trend
The aerospace industry is constantly seeking to reduce aircraft weight to improve fuel efficiency and reduce emissions. This is driving the development of lighter and stronger adhesives that can bond lightweight materials like composites and honeycomb structures, reducing the need for heavy mechanical fasteners.Sustainability Focus
The aviation industry is committed to reducing its environmental impact. Adhesive manufacturers are incorporating more sustainable materials and manufacturing processes, focusing on low-VOC (Volatile Organic Compounds) formulations, recycled materials, and increased durability to minimize the need for frequent replacement.Passenger Comfort and Aesthetics
Airlines are increasingly focusing on enhancing the passenger experience, with a greater emphasis on comfort and aesthetics. This is driving the development of adhesives that can bond a wider range of materials, including advanced composites, textiles, and decorative finishes, creating a more pleasing and comfortable cabin environment.Enhanced Safety Features
The industry is prioritizing safety, leading to the development of fire-resistant adhesives that meet strict flammability standards. These adhesives are designed to minimize the spread of fire and smoke in the event of an incident, improving passenger safety.Drivers
Several factors are expected to propel the growth of the Aerospace Interior Adhesives Market in the coming years
Growth in Air Travel
The global air travel market is expected to continue growing, leading to an increased demand for new aircraft and, in turn, the need for more adhesives for interior applications.New Aircraft Designs
New aircraft designs are often introducing larger cabin sizes and more spacious seating configurations, requiring innovative adhesive solutions for bonding different materials and structures.Focus on Cabin Interior Upgrades
Airlines are investing in upgrading their cabin interiors to enhance the passenger experience. This includes using adhesives to bond new materials, designs, and technologies to improve comfort, aesthetics, and safety.Sustainability Regulations
The industry is facing growing pressure to reduce its environmental impact, driving the demand for sustainable adhesives made from recycled materials and incorporating eco-friendly manufacturing processes.Challenges
Despite its immense potential, the Aerospace Interior Adhesives Market faces several challenges
Cost Factor
Developing and manufacturing aerospace adhesives with specialized properties and stringent performance requirements can be expensive, which can limit their adoption, particularly in cost-sensitive markets.Certification and Compliance
Ensuring the safety and reliability of adhesives used in aerospace applications requires rigorous testing and certification processes, which can be time-consuming and complex.Durability and Performance
Ensuring the long-term durability and performance of adhesives under extreme operating conditions, including temperature changes, humidity, and vibration, is critical. Extensive testing and validation are necessary to ensure that these materials meet stringent performance standards.Weight Optimization
Balancing the weight-saving benefits of new adhesives with the strength and durability required for aerospace applications is an ongoing challenge for the industry.Competitive Landscape
